Huawei Canada has an immediate 12-month contract opening for a Recruiter.About the team:As a strategic partner supporting all of Huawei Canada, the Human Resource Department plays a pivotal role in attracting, developing, and retaining top talent while ensuring compliance with corporate and legal standards. By prioritizing employee well-being and professional growth, this department cultivates a culture of collaboration and success. The Human Resource Department is committed to aligning workforce strategies with Huawei’s vision, driving sustainable growth and organizational effectiveness.About the job:Design and execute comprehensive recruitment strategies for technical and research positions, with a focus on AI and software rolesSource candidates through multiple channels including professional networks, online platforms, industry events, and academic institutionsScreen resumes, conduct initial interviews, and coordinate with hiring managers throughout the selection processBuild and maintain relationships with universities, research institutions, and professional communities to create talent pipelinesStay current on market trends, compensation benchmarks, and competitive recruiting practices in the tech and AI sectorsManage the candidate experience from initial contact through onboardingTrack recruitment metrics and regularly report on hiring progressCollaborate with hiring managers to understand technical requirements and translate them into effective job descriptionsThe target annual compensation (based on 2080 hours per year) ranges from $48,000 to $94,000 depending on education, experience and demonstrated expertise.About the ideal candidate:Produces high-quality results with minimal supervisionMaintains a positive attitude and collaborates effectively with team membersQuickly builds relationships with hard-to-find candidatesPassionate about talent acquisition, knowledgeable about industry best practices, and innovative in talent attraction strategiesResults-oriented and proactive with a strong “can-do” attitudeConfident in recruitment skills and possesses strong negotiation abilitiesProficient in MS Office SuiteExperienced in managing multiple open vacancies and prioritizing hiring needs effectively
